Output 58f40f89bc62b50c2ba091fd1c97fd0d28236191745837dc0a208b8da53a722d:11

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 160f41969d781ff3253fd5788752786cadb81e68eb36308ad9cfdcac32ae4eb4
address
tb1pzc85r95a0q0lxffl64ugw5ncdjkms8ngavmrpzkeelw2cv4wf66qqxph9e
transaction
58f40f89bc62b50c2ba091fd1c97fd0d28236191745837dc0a208b8da53a722d
confirmations
70307
spent
true